Scoping Review: Emerging (Bio)markers for the Early Detection of Breast Cancer Recurrence

2024-06-12

Abstract excerpt

<title>Abstract</title> <p><bold>Background </bold>The aim of this study is to gain a comprehensive understanding of the latest advancements in breast cancer recurrence markers, with the aim of identifying minimally invasive or minimally intrusive markers as necessary approach for screening for breast cancer recurrence. <bold>Methods </bold>We followed PRISMA guidelines, systematically searching Web of Science, S...
